Lately, after doing an update of JabRef or Java (I don't remember which), I get an error message saying:
Microsoft Visual C++ Runtime Library
Runtime Error!
Program: C:\...\TEXCNTR.EXE
This application has requested the Runtime to terminate it in an unusual way. Please contact the application's support team for more information.
when I run TeXnicCenter and JabRef at the same time. Then TeXnicCenter closes.
I run TeXnicCenter 1 Beta 7.01 -unstable ('Greengrass') and JabRef 2.2
What is causing this error, and what can I do to avoid it?

Runtime error when running TeXnicCenter and JabRef
It turns out I still have the problem, but I have discovered that the problem only occurs when both JabRef and TeXnicCenter are accessing the bib-file.
e.g. if the bib-file is opened in JabRef and the whole project is opened in TeXnicCenter (including the bib-file).
If only the tex-file is opened, not the whole project, the problem does not occur.
If, as suggested by chris2u2, the project is opened in TeXnicCenter first and later the bib-file is opened in JabRef everything works fine until I save the project in TeXnicCenter. Then it crashes.
So for the time being the "solution" to the problem is:
-Open the bib-file in JabRef
-Open the tex-file in TeXnicCenter
-Write the tex-file
when building project:
-Close JabRef
-Open and build project in TeXnicCenter
My current set of software:
TeXnicCenter 1 Beta 7.01 -unstable ('Greengrass')
JabRef 2.3b
Java version 6 update 2

Re: Runtime error when running TeXnicCenter and JabRef Topic is solved
I was also working on TeXnic center 1.0 SRC 1 and Jabref 2.7.2. I had Java V6.32 and everything work fine.
When I updated Java to V7 update 7, the run time error appeared.
I tried removing the new Java, but nothing worked.
I finally removed all previous Java installations, installed Java V7 update 7 again and removed Jabref 2.7.2 and installed 2.8.1 and that seems to have solved my problem.
As far as I see, this has something to do with Java and its compatibility to Jabref.
